The Khanda Sahib was introduced by the 6th Guru Hargobind Singh Ji as a part of the Nishan Sahib (The Sikh Flag) to symbolize Sikh faith and identity, comprising of a double edged sword, a circle (Chakkar), and two kirpans representing the Sikh doctrine of “Deg Tegh Fateh” (power, charity, and victory), with the integration of the temporal (Miri ) and spiritual (Piri) and emphasizing the balance of the dual authority.
